Audit item 7 — rate limiting on the Marrowgate internal API gateway. Confirm the per-team quota tiers match the published Halcrest policy and that burst limits return a clear retry header. Support should not raise limits ad hoc; all exceptions go through the quota request form. Final approval for any rate-limit exception rests with the person named below.

account owner for fajep-yagef: Kasix Eliiel

## Brightmoor Series – Pricing (Managers Only)

This page sets out the approved pricing structure for the Brightmoor product line. List prices reflect a 42% target margin, with tiered volume adjustments capped at 12%. Regional uplifts apply in the Varenport market only. Finance should verify all quotes against these bands before approval. The rationale behind the cap is as follows.

board note of bajop-yaweg: The western region missed its Pelys quota by 58.0 percent last quarter. Pelysek Foods plans to raise the Belius list price by 44.0 percent in July. The steering committee signed off on a budget of $133.8 million for Project Pelax. The renewal with Zoraelix Systems closes at $61.9 million a year, 12.7 percent above the last contract.

Q3 Planning Note — Revised Commission Scheme

Heads up, everyone: the sales-commission model for the Brellick product family is changing next quarter. Flat 6% goes away; we're moving to a tiered structure that rewards multi-year deals and renewals rather than one-off volume. Early modelling by Tomas in Revenue Ops suggests most reps land slightly ahead, but a few big-ticket hunters will grumble. Please brief your teams before the Harwick offsite so nobody's blindsided. Context on why we're doing this now follows.

board note of fahap-yafop: Headcount on the Istion team goes from 50 to 73 by the end of September. Gross margin on Istion came in at 33 percent against a plan of 28 percent.

## Deployment

So, quick background: the Orchardline GraphQL API used to fire one database query per order line item, which melted the replica every Friday. We fixed it with a batching dataloader, but the fix only kicks in if the deploy picks up the right settings — otherwise you're back to N+1 land and support tickets about slow carts. Deploy via the usual pipeline, then confirm the batcher is enabled in the pod logs. The values the deploy should apply are listed here.

deployment values, yadup-kadug:
[sorys]
port = 5672
team = noveth
host = sorys.orvexcorp.example
region = south-4
access_code = ac_deddc1
timeout_ms = 1500